Our Sewer Backup Process

Here is how we handle every sewer backup project in Gainesville.

1

Inspection & Diagnosis

Scranton Sewer Authority begins every sewer backup project with a thorough camera inspection. We document findings, diagnose the root cause, and explain every option available for your Gainesville, TX property.

2

Clear the Blockage

Our Gainesville crew uses professional-grade snaking and hydro jetting equipment to break through the blockage and flush debris from the line. We verify results with camera inspection.

3

Repair & Restore

If the camera reveals pipe damage, we repair it using traditional or trenchless methods. We fix cracks, offsets, and root intrusion points to prevent the problem from recurring.

4

Final Verification & Cleanup

Scranton Sewer Authority does not consider the job complete until a final camera inspection confirms full flow and structural integrity at your Gainesville property. We provide documentation of all work performed and review the results with you.
